    GEORGE ANDERSON FROM HOWWOOD AND JOHNSTONE SENTENCED FOR DECADES OF ABUSE AND RAPE

    In December 2014, a disturbing case concluded at the High Court in Glasgow involving George Anderson, a 63-year-old man from Johnstone, who was found guilty of heinous crimes spanning nearly two decades. Anderson, who once operated a fruit and vegetable shop in Johnstone, was convicted of raping a 14-year-old girl and abusing five other young females over a period of 19 years, from May 1973 to August 1992. The court heard that his criminal activities took place at various addresses in both Johnstone and Howwood, locations where he exploited his position of trust and authority over vulnerable young girls.

    During the sentencing, Judge Johanna Johnston QC addressed Anderson directly, emphasizing the gravity of his offenses. She stated, “These crimes were committed on young girls and young women. You exploited your position as a trusted adult. Some of these victims were vulnerable.” The judge highlighted the escalation of Anderson’s misconduct, noting that he eventually raped a young girl and attempted to rape another, actions that left lasting scars on the victims. She further remarked, “This has had a lasting and devastating effect on this young girl. Your criminal conduct has had a devastating effect on your victims.”

    Anderson’s actions included raping one victim in the back of a converted ambulance, which he used as a mobile fruit and vegetable selling unit, and sexually abusing another woman with the intent to rape her. Other victims were subjected to inappropriate groping and unwanted sexual advances. Despite the severity of the allegations, Anderson maintained his innocence throughout the trial, claiming that all the victims were fabricating their stories against him.

    His arrest and subsequent trial were prompted after one of his victims, a young woman, and her father confronted him at his home. During this confrontation, the victim accused Anderson of raping her, to which he responded, “I’ve been expecting this.” However, during his court appearance, Anderson denied the rape allegations, asserting that the sexual encounters were consensual and that the girl was a willing participant. Advocate depute Jim Keegan QC challenged Anderson’s claims, asking, “Are you so irresistible that a young girl would willingly engage in sexual intercourse with you?” to which Anderson replied, “Yes.”

    Further evidence revealed Anderson’s attempt at remorse through a letter of apology he sent in 1973 to a girl he had abused when she was 12 years old. The letter read, “I am so sorry for my behaviour all those years ago. I just hope you can find ways to forgive me.” Anderson admitted to sending the letter but insisted it was unrelated to the sexual abuse. One of his victims described him as a “sleazy, dirty old man,” and recounted how he told her, “I’m going to have you.”

    Anderson’s defense team, led by Kevin McCallum, argued that he continued to deny all allegations, citing his health issues, including diabetes and a heart condition. They also highlighted personal tragedies in his life, such as the death of his daughter in a road traffic accident on Boxing Day 1995 and the murder of his son in 2004.

    Following the evidence and testimonies, Judge Johnston ordered Anderson to be placed on the sex offenders register and sentenced him to eight years in prison for his crimes. As he was led away, Anderson winked at members of his family, a gesture that underscored the gravity and personal impact of the proceedings. The case has left a lasting mark on the community of Johnstone and Howwood, highlighting the importance of justice for victims of sexual abuse and exploitation.
